Man Killed in Car Accident on Wisconsin Ave.

A 29-year-old man from Ireland was killed in a four car accident in Washington D.C. early Saturday morning.  The victim worked at the Courtyard by Marriott Hotel.

The collision remains under investigation, but D.C. police spokesman Sgt. Joe Gentile said at this time speed and alcohol appear to be contributing factors.

Police closed Wisconsin Avenue for a time in both directions near Woodley Road to allow the department’s major crash unit to complete their investigation.

The 42-year-old driver of the vehicle that caused the accident has been charged with second-degree murder.
